Education and Research Experience

  • 2017-Current, Associate Professor, Shanghai Jiao Tong University
  • 2010-2016, Research Scientist and Postdoc,Washington University in St. Louis, USA
  • 2008-2010, Postdoc, South China Sea Institute of Oceanology, Chinese Academy of Sciences, China
  • 2019-Current, the Editorial Board of Applied and Environmental Microbiology
